Material and Build Quality
High-quality stainless steel resists rust and is easy to clean, extending the lifespan of your scoop. Cheaper metals or coatings can wear off or corrode over time, especially with frequent washing. Look for options labeled 18/8 or food-grade stainless steel for peace of mind. A sturdy construction with smooth edges also minimizes food trapping and makes cleaning simpler. Investing in quality pays off with durability and safer food handling, especially if you regularly scoop sticky or oily ingredients.
Handle Design and Ergonomics
Comfortable, long handles reduce strain during extended use and help reach into deep jars or containers. A non-slip grip enhances control, especially when working with wet or greasy ingredients. Short handles may be less tiring but might limit reach, making them less versatile. Consider whether you prefer a scoop with a handle that stays cool or one with a textured grip for better hold. Well-designed handles improve safety and efficiency, especially during busy kitchen moments.
Ease of Cleaning and Maintenance
Smooth, seamless surfaces without crevices prevent food buildup and make cleaning easier. Dishwasher-safe scoops save time and reduce manual scrubbing. Avoid scoops with painted or coated surfaces that might chip or degrade over time. Regular maintenance with simple cleaning ensures your scoop stays hygienic and functional for years. Think about how often you’ll need to sanitize your tools and choose a design that simplifies this process.

Is stainless steel safe for all types of ingredients?
Yes, food-grade stainless steel is widely regarded as safe for all kitchen ingredients. It does not rust or corrode when properly maintained, and it resists staining and odors. Unlike plastic, stainless steel won’t leach chemicals, making it a healthier choice for food contact. Just ensure your scoop is made from high-quality, food-grade steel to avoid contamination or degradation over time.
How important is handle length for a scoop?
Handle length impacts reach and control, especially when working with deep containers or large jars. Longer handles reduce strain and make scooping from tall or wide containers easier. Shorter handles are more compact and easier to store but may require more effort to reach into deep storage. Choose a handle length that matches your storage setup and comfort preferences; ergonomic design can make a significant difference during extended use.
Can I use the same scoop for both dry and wet ingredients?
Absolutely, a well-made stainless steel scoop can handle both dry and wet ingredients without issues. Stainless steel resists corrosion and staining, making it suitable for sticky, oily, or watery substances. Just remember to rinse and dry your scoop thoroughly after use with wet ingredients to maintain its appearance and hygiene. Having a versatile scoop reduces the need for multiple tools and simplifies cleaning routines.
